Analyzing the genetic relationships of the main Auricularia auricular cultispecies in Qinba mountainous area by ITS sequence so as to lay a theoretical foundation to genetics and breeding. Using CTAB method to extract genomic DNA from the bacterial strain, Auricularia auricular, and amplifying and sequencing PCR products; Auricularia auricula-judae 2 and Auricularia auricula-judae HF-8(GQ168492) were clustered in the same branch, Auricularia auricula-judae 913 and Auricularia auricula-judae YBS-7(GQ168503) were clustered in the same branch, but the genetic relationship between Auricularia auricula-judae Shennong A8 and the Auricularia auricula-judae 2, Auricularia auricula-judae 913 were relatively alienative. Auricularia auricula-judae 97-2, Auricularia auricula-judae NW482(EU520194), the Auricularia auricula-judae 268 and Auricularia auricula-judae NW491 (EU520160) were clustered in the same branch. However the genetic relationships among Auricularia auricula-judae Qindan 4, Auricularia auricula-judae 97-2, Auricularia auricula-judae 268 were relatively alienative. The genetic relationships among Auricularia auricula-judae Xinke, Auricularia auricula-judae 2, Auricularia auricula-judae 913 and Auricularia auricula-judae Shennong A8 were close. However, the relationships between Auricularia auricula-judae 268, Auricularia auricula-judae Qindan 4# and Auricularia auricula-judae 97-2 were quite far. Through the morphologic and ITS analysis of Auricularia auricular strains, two dominant strains, Auricularia auricula-judae Qindan 4# and Auricularia auricula-judae Shennong A8, have alienative relationship. Our findings established a solid foundation to genetics and breeding.
